## Fenwick Relay — Environments

FD leak hunt, staging. Fenwick Relay exhausted descriptors after ~36h uptime; culprit was unclosed sockets in the retry path. Patched in build 4.2.1. Staging mirrors prod except for the descriptor ulimit, which we deliberately lowered to reproduce faster. Audit the limits before signing off. The staging instance currently runs with the following configuration values.

deployment values, yadup-kadug:
[sorys]
port = 5672
team = noveth
host = sorys.orvexcorp.example
region = south-4
access_code = ac_deddc1
timeout_ms = 1500

## Tuning the SQL linter

The Querystone linter runs on every SQL file committed to the Larkfield warehouse repo. If on-call gets paged for CI lint failures, check the rule thresholds before touching individual queries. Most noise comes from the max-join-depth and identifier-length rules, which were calibrated for the old reporting schema. Adjust conservatively and rerun the full suite. The current tuning constants are as follows.

constants for tageg-kagag:
QUOTAS = {
    "kelax": 495,
    "istath": 366,
    "tammir": 108,
    "novdor": 730,
    "casax": 816,
    "quenael": 874,
    "pelius": 403,
}

Dark-mode rendering in the Loomhaven admin dashboard is failing for users whose theme preference is set to "system." The media query listener registers before the theme store hydrates, so the dashboard falls back to light tokens while charts render with dark palettes, producing unreadable axis labels. This affects roughly a third of admin sessions since the Tuesday release. The fix should gate the listener on store readiness rather than mount order. Reproduction steps and screenshots are collected on the triage page.

runbook for badug-kadup: https://confluence.zemvarlabs.internal/projects/browse/display/projects/bd1b

Handover note — Crumbwheel order cutoffs.

Welcome aboard. The bakery cutoff rule in Crumbwheel closes same-day orders at 14:00 local to each storefront, not UTC — this has bitten us twice. Holiday overrides live in the calendar service and take precedence silently, so always check there first when a cutoff looks wrong. To unlock the calendar service's admin console after a restart, enter the recovery passphrase below.

vault phrase of bagap-bahaf = silion-pelox-sorox-casdor-quenwyn-fraax-eliox-praael-kelion-quenvan-kasox-rusael-norius-belvan